Style & Size Code
Style
C — Ceramic
D — Dielectric, fixed Chip
R — Established Reliability
Rated Temperature
-55°C to +125°C
Dielectrics
P — 0±30ppm/°C
X — ±15% from -55°C to +125°C with 0VDC Bias
+15%/-25% from -55°C to +125°C with WVDC Bias
Capacitance
Expressed in picofarads (pF)
First 2 digits represent significant figures and the last digit specifies
the number of zeros to follow. Example: 103 — 10,000 picofarads.
When nominal value is less than 10pF, the letter “R” is used to
indicate the decimal point. Example: 1R0 — 1.0pF; R75—0.75pF;
0R5—0.5pF.
Failure Rate Level
M = 1.0% (%/1000hrs.)
P = 0.1
R = 0.01
S = 0.001
Termination Finish
S — Solder Coated, Final (SolderGuard I)
U— Base Metallization Barrier Metal—
Solder Coated (SolderGuard I)
W— Base Metallization—Barrier Metal—
Tinned (Tin or Tin/Lead Alloy)
(SolderGuard II)
Y— Base Metallization Barrier Metal—
100% tin coated (SolderGuard II)
Capacitance Tolerance
BC
D F JK M
±.1pF ±.25pF ±.5pF ±1% ±5% ±10% ±20%
Rated Voltage
A—50; B—100
